Pros

Amazing people, good work life balance, amazing benefits, unsurpassed retirement benefits.

Cons

Pharma performance dragged down by Xarelto and Eyelea going off patent, coupled with Monsanto lawsuits depressing the stock, your LTI and STI barely hit the target. Salary is barely median within industry, yet HR takes the stance it's competitive. Oncology pipeline has dried up, new management not able to make a decision on acquisitions to save their life and their entire pipeline commercialization team has been dissolved (their BD&L team is led by a confused lady, at best). They are hanging by a Nubeqa thread that has a peak potential of 4bn, yet Bayer has 100bn of debt on the books. So get promoted and move up, then move on.
